Virginia Family Services (VFS) is on the lookout for a passionate and experienced Licensed Professional Counselor (LPC) or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W) to join our team as a Senior Clinician.

At VFS, we are committed to delivering exceptional behavioral health services that empower individuals and families across Virginia.

Position Overview :

As the Senior Clinician, you will play a pivotal role in supporting the Clinical Department at VFS. You will work closely with Clinical Supervisors, ensuring compliance with VFS standards, managing staff, and overseeing the delivery of services to our clients.

This is an in-person position based in Richmond, VA, where you will supervise and guide our dedicated team of Clinical Supervisors in the Addiction Recovery Treatment Services Department.

Programs Include Substance Use Intensive Outpatient, and Substance Use Partial Hospitalization.

Key Responsibilities :

  • Supervise and provide support to Clinical Supervisors in maintaining high-quality service delivery and compliance with federal, state, and local regulations.
  • Oversee clinical documentation, ensuring accuracy and adherence to company standards.
  • Collaborate with Clinical Supervisors to address staffing, documentation, and community relationship-building.
  • Foster partnerships within the community to enhance care coordination for our clients.
  • Assist with marketing efforts to help meet company census goals.
  • Utilize company systems, databases, and software effectively within the scope of your duties.
  • Ensure adherence to company policies, procedures, and confidentiality standards, including HIPAA compliance.
  • Attend and participate in required training, meetings, and supervision sessions.
  • Demonstrate strong ethical practice and client relationship management.

Qualifications :

  • Master’s Degree in Psychology or a related Human Services field.
  • Active Virginia licensure as a Licensed Professional Counselor (LPC) or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W).
  • Minimum of three (3) years of supervisory experience.
  • Minimum of five (5) years of clinical experience in community-based services, working with children, adolescents, and adults.
  • Valid Virginia State Driver's License, automobile insurance, and a positive driving record.
  • Eligible Background Required

Required Skills and Abilities :

  • Strong ethical practice with excellent client relationship and interpersonal skills.
  • Competency in assessment, counseling, and crisis intervention, particularly in Substance Use Disorder (SUD) and Mental Health (MH) contexts.
  • Familiarity with ASAM Criteria and DSM-V.
  • Ability to manage multiple projects, delegate tasks effectively, and maintain high standards of work.
  • Strong attention to detail and commitment to meeting deadlines.
  • Ability to handle aggressive behaviors with appropriate interventions.
  • Proficiency in written and spoken communication.
  • Strong computer skills, including proficiency with Word and Excel.
  • Previous experience in case management and related documentation.
